Frequently Asked Questions
How soon should I call you to begin the clean-up? As soon as possible. Ideally we recommend 24-48 hours after flooding occurs.
I think sewage water has flooded my home. Will you still clean that? Of course! It’s pretty common for flood water to contain sewage and other contaminants. We will thoroughly sanitize your carpet, tile, and other surfaces as part of the cleaning process.
Can flood water cause mold? Yes, absolutely. A moist humid environment is the perfect place for mold to grow. That is one of the reasons to take action as soon as possible as mold can be a dangerous health hazard.
How long does a water damage restoration take? Every situation is different, but it usually takes between 3-5 days depending on the amount of water and the loss.
